Australian Science at Work Exhibitions


Australian Science at Work online exhibitions are similar to museum exhibitions,
with stories to tell and virtual paths to wander down!

They are a great resource for teachers and students at all levels,
as well as a fascinating place to browse and learn more about
Australia's scientific, technological and medical heritage.





Guides to Current Research in Victorian Universities Guides to Current Research in Victorian Universities

The Australian Science and Technology Heritage Centre has produced HTML versions of the Guides to Current Research in Victorian Universities published by the Victorian Department of State and Regional Development. The guides are linked to the entries for the universities in Australian Science at Work.
